What you will be doing
- Leading audit assignments for a mix of commercial and charity clients, from the planning stage right through to completion
- Making sure audit files are clear, complete and well organised
- Reviewing client records, analysing accounting data and offering practical recommendations
- Keeping work fully aligned with regulatory standards, internal methodology and risk management expectations
- Building strong relationships with clients and acting as a trusted point of contact
- Identifying what each client truly needs and putting effective solutions in place
- Responding to queries promptly and maintaining a positive and professional tone at all times
- Supporting junior team members and helping them develop their confidence and technical ability
- Working closely with colleagues to deliver timely and accurate work
- Preparing and reviewing accounts, tax filings, VAT submissions and PAYE documents
- Managing your own workload so that deadlines are met and work is ready for sign off
- Making good use of available tools and technology to drive efficiency and maintain high standards
